Roxley Masevhe Has Been Arrested

Bishop Roxley Masevhe, a 64-year-old prominent figure in Thohoyandou, Venda, was arrested in early January on suspicion of beating his stepson. Masevhe has made great contributions to the music business in addition to his function as a well-known prophet in the community. His arrest has sparked debate and raised concerns about the alleged incident. Masevhe appeared before legal authorities on January 9, and the matter was transferred to a higher court.
